Not to open up old wounds, well maybe really to open up old wounds, Car and Driver did a comparo between the ZO6 the GT3 and the Lotus S. The ZO6 was number one, but it did only win by 1 point in CD's testing proceedure. The Lotus was 3rd.

It was one of those typical subjective tests where the faster car won, but only by a little since they liked the interior so much better in the Porsche. Since they were journalists they didnt care that the Porsche was $60,000 more.

This was only a GT3 not the GT3RS used in this threads test.
